Doing Business with NAVSEA


 
NAVSEA keeps America’s Navy #1 in the world by providing operationally superior and affordable ships, systems and ordnance for today, for tomorrow, and for the Navy after next. 
 
NAVSEA currently contracts for the following services:
- Ships, shipboard weapons and combat systems
- Design and integrating
- Maintenance and repair
- Modernization and conversion
- Technical, industrial and logistic support
- Other professional services, such as engineering, finance and program management
 
For current procurement opportunities and general contracting information, businesses should visit:
 
FedBizOpps.gov is the single government point-of-entry (GPE) for Federal government procurement opportunities over $25,000. Government buyers are able to publicize their business opportunities by posting information directly to FedBizOpps via the Internet. Through one portal - FedBizOpps (FBO) - commercial vendors seeking Federal markets for their products and services can search, monitor and retrieve opportunities solicited by the entire Federal contracting community.
 
Navy Electronic Commerce Online https://www.neco.navy.mil/
NECO allows users to search a Navy database which contains current procurement transactions such as Request for Quotations (RFQs) and Request for Proposals (RFPs) as well as amendments and cancellation notices.
 
SeaPort Enhanced (SeaPort-e) is the Navy Virtual SYSCOM Commanders’ (NAVAIR, NAVSEA, NAVSUP and SPAWAR) integrated approach to contracting for support services. SeaPort-e has made electronic procurement of Engineering, Financial, and Program Management support services a reality. The SeaPort-e portal provides a standardized means of issuing competitive solicitations amongst a large & diverse community of approved contractors, as well as a platform for awarding & managing performance-based task orders. This unified approach allows SeaPort-e service procurement teams to leverage their best work products, practices, & approaches across the Navy's critical service business sector.
 

Small Business Opportunities


Small Businesses are encouraged to visit the Department of Defense Office of Small Business Programs  and the Navy’s Office of Small Business Programs.

NAVSEA can assist small businesses, including veteran-owned, service-disabled veteran-owned, HUBZone, small disadvantaged, and women-owned small business concerns in marketing their products and services to NAVSEA.
